include:_spf.google.com is Google Workspace, which is where staff read mail. It says nothing about where campaigns leave from, and a checker that counts it as your sending platform has told you about your inbox, not your list.
This is what your DNS authorises, not proof of what you send. A domain can authorise a platform it stopped paying for two years ago, which is why an include on its own is reported as permission rather than as use, and it can carry live keys for a platform it never authorised, which is the reverse and the more expensive of the two. Only a real message names the address that actually sent your campaign.

Mailchimp signs your mail, and nothing you publish names it
2 of Mailchimp's selectors carry live keys here, so Mailchimp is signing mail as you. Neither your record nor any of the subdomains bulk mail is normally sent from mentions Mailchimp; your SPF names Google Workspace and Zendesk. That is not automatically wrong: if Mailchimp sends with its own return-path domain, which is the default on every major platform, your SPF is never consulted on those messages and they pass on alone. What it does mean is that this channel has no SPF to fall back on — one key rotated, revoked or mis-copied and there is nothing underneath it.

Part platform, part you
Send one campaign through Mailchimp to yourself and read the Authentication-Results header. If it says =pass, the envelope is on Mailchimp's domain and there is nothing to do. If it says spf=fail or softfail, you are sending with your own domain as the envelope and Mailchimp's include: belongs in your SPF.

SendGrid is authorised on email.figma.com
SendGrid signs mail as this domain, and the root record does not name it — which on its own looks like a mismatch. It is not: email.figma.com publishes its own SPF naming SendGrid, and SPF is evaluated against the envelope domain rather than the root. This is the normal setup for bulk mail on a subdomain.

Each of these answered an entry it is required to publish, and one it is required not to, before we believed anything it said about you. A list that fails either is reported as unanswered rather than as clean — because a blocklist that declines to reply looks exactly like one giving you the all-clear. How we choose them.
